site stats

Evaluating software architecture

Webevaluation. 1.1.2 Software Architecture.In the literature, software architecture is defined in many ways. In our work, we use the definition introduced by ISO/IEC/IEEE … WebDec 13, 2011 · Evaluating software architectures is a critical part of the software architecture lifecycle processes. The book "Evaluating Software Architectures: …

Evaluation of Software Architectures under Uncertainty: A …

WebOct 22, 2001 · Book. ISBN-10: 0-201-70482-X. ISBN-13: 978-0-201-70482-2. The foundation of any software system is its architecture. Using this book, you can evaluate every aspect of architecture in advance, at remarkably low cost -- identifying improvements that can dramatically improve any system's performance, security, reliability, and … hersh saluja https://cathleennaughtonassoc.com

3.3.2 – Analyzing and Evaluating an Architecture - Architecture in ...

WebJan 1, 2006 · Processes for evaluating software architecture (SA) help to investigate problems and potential risks in SA. It is derived from many studies that proposed a plethora of systematic SA evaluation ... WebDependencies among software entities are the foundation for much of the research on software architecture analysis and architecture analysis tools. Dynamically typed languages, such as Python, JavaScript and Ruby, tolerate the lack of explicit type references, making certain dependencies indiscernible by a purely syntactic analysis of … WebDec 2, 2024 · Processes for evaluating software architecture (SA) help to investigate problems and potential risks in SA. It is derived from many studies that proposed a … hersi kopani

Software architecture - Wikipedia

Category:Lightweight Software Architecture Evaluation for Industry: A ...

Tags:Evaluating software architecture

Evaluating software architecture

Evaluation of Software Architectures under Uncertainty: A …

WebSep 25, 2012 · He is a coauthor of Evaluating Software Architectures: Methods and Case Studies, (Addison-Wesley, 2002). Rick’s primary research interests are software architecture, design and analysis tools, software visualization, and software engineering economics. He is also interested in human-computer interaction and information retrieval. WebContinuous Software Architecture Analysis. Georg Buchgeher, Rainer Weinreich, in Agile Software Architecture, 2014. 7.3.2 Scenario-based evaluation methods. Scenario …

Evaluating software architecture

Did you know?

WebJun 30, 2024 · Software development estimates should be more than just a quote. In addition to defining the system’s features and functionality, it should provide a detailed description of the activities that will be performed to ensure the project is successful. In other words, it should be a well-developed and comprehensive proposal. WebSoftware architecture has become a widely accepted conceptual basis for the development of nontrivial software in all application areas and by organizations of all sizes. However, the treatment of architecture to date has largely concentrated on its design and, to a lesser extent, its validation. Effectively documenting an architecture is as...

WebJan 12, 2011 · The thesis also introduces a software called SAPE (Software Architecture Performance Evaluation), that -- as its name already suggests -- is meant to help with … WebDec 2, 2024 · Software Architecture : Software Architecture defines fundamental organization of a system and more simply defines a structured solution. It defines how components of a software system are assembled, their relationship and communication between them. It serves as a blueprint for software application and development basis …

WebJun 25, 2024 · 1. Conduct needs analysis: put the “why” before the “how”. You can’t evaluate a software tool if you don’t identify the target outcome of using that software. … WebEvaluating Software Architectures Tu E Pdf When somebody should go to the ebook stores, search opening by shop, shelf by shelf, it is in point of fact ... Architectures, …

WebApr 13, 2024 · Analyze and synthesize the site data. The fourth step is to analyze and synthesize the site data, and how they help you evaluate and compare different site options and alternatives.

WebIn the Capstone Project you will document a Java-based Android application with UML diagrams and analyze evaluate the application’s architecture using the Architecture … hersine jobsWebSep 12, 2007 · An approach in evaluating software architecture is reasoning about the quality attributes a software architecture exhibits. In the bullets below, I tried to sum up the different quality attributes together with some typical things to look for when you're conducting a review. This list is not intended to be exhaustive. hersir koti talliWebJul 28, 2024 · Software evaluation requires careful consideration and analysis of the following: Your business needs. Every business is unique; a freelance graphic designer will need very different accounting software than a construction company. ... One isn’t necessarily better than the other; it simply depends on the architecture and adaptability … hersi moallinWebDec 2, 2024 · Processes for evaluating software architecture (SA) help to investigate problems and potential risks in SA. It is derived from many studies that proposed a plethora of systematic SA evaluation methods, while industrial practitioners currently refrain from applying them since they are heavyweight. Nowadays, heterogeneous software … hersi saidWebDec 1, 2016 · Abstract. In software systems, the software architecture evaluation methods play major role to increase the software quality attributes like maintainability … hersinoiseWebSep 8, 2024 · Methods for Evaluating Software Architecture. This Advisor explores the use of the ISO/IEC 25010 quality model as a software architecture evaluation method. … hersonissos hotel kreta opinieWebEnlist the vendor’s help. Choose one person to serve as single point of contact with the vendor, says Jamie Kurt, technical solutions architect at Functionize. (If you’re reading this essay, the champion is probably you.) A single contact minimizes miscommunication and orchestrates the technical side of the evaluation process. hershey kisses lava cake kiss